interactive-session

A routing skill for plain-text messages sent during an open coding session. It adds each follow-up to the existing session instead of starting a separate one.

In plain words
What is it for?
Use it when continuing work after a session-start command, including questions, implementation requests, and other messages that do not use a command prefix.
Why use it?
It keeps the conversation and session record together, so follow-up requests do not create duplicate sessions or lose context.

Interactive Session

Owner: orchestrator Consumers: /kon:begin — all follow-up messages without a /kon: prefix

Core principles (always): follow skills/core-principles — first principles (don't hide the issue); simplest, most concise correct solution.

Detect active session

python3 $KON_ROOT/scripts/kon_session.py active
# prints session id, or nothing

Active = most recent command: "/kon:begin" with status in in_progress | waiting for this project.

If active prints an id → user is in interactive mode unless they sent an explicit /kon:* command.

Golden rule

Never call init for sub-turns inside a begin session.

Append work to the existing session:

python3 $KON_ROOT/scripts/kon_session.py log-turn \
  --id <begin-sid> --agent User --summary "<one line paraphrase>"

python3 $KON_ROOT/scripts/kon_session.py complete-agent \
  --id <begin-sid> --agent Azusa --summary "<one sentence>"

Begin sessions stay in_progress after each agent — only /kon:finish closes them.

Intent routing (plain text)

Signal Route Agent(s)
Question about our code / "where is…" / "how does X work" ask 🎸 Azusa read-only
External docs / API / "look up…" research 📚 Jun
Review diff / "check my changes" review 📝 Mio
Review PR / holistic PR check / "review this PR" review-pr 📝 Mio
Summarize issue / GitHub issue thread describe-issue 📚 Jun
Bug / failing test / regression / "X is broken" debug 🎸 Azusa → 🍰 Mugi → User → 🎶 Yui → 🧹 Sawako → 📝 Mio
Small fix, typo, one file quick 🎶 Yui → 📝 Mio
Feature, multi-file, unclear scope team Azusa → pre-plan gate → Mugi → …
Design first, no code yet design Azusa → pre-plan gate → Mugi → debate
Todo / "remind me to…" / add to list todo run kon_todo.py add (no agent)
Greeting / meta / "what can you do" orchestrator no agent spawn — reply + log-turn User
